Low cost smart walking stick design with smart sensors for the visually impaired

Abstract (EN)
It is assumedthatapproximately 285 millionpeople in theworldarevisuallyimpaired. Of these, 39 millionwererecorded as "blind" and 246 million as "lowvision". Theremay be manyreasonsforvisualimpairment. Geneticpredispositionandmarriagetorelativesarethe main causes of eyedefects in ourcountry. Inaddition, severe visualimpairmentmayoccurduetoreasonssuch as accidents, injuriesandbraindamage. Nowadays, weactivelyusetechnology in everyaspect of ourlives. Various hardware and software areproducedsothatvisuallyimpairedpeople can livetheirlivesmorecomfortably, likenon-disabledindividuals. Thankstothesmartcanedesignedwiththisstudy, it is aimedtoraisethelivingstandards of disabledindividuals. Byintegratingelectronicdevicesintoourdesignedsmartcane, thevisuallyimpairedcanewill be madesmart. Thepurpose of thisstudy is todesignoursmartcaneboth in hardware and software. Three differenthardwareswereused. These; It is GPS module, Arduino Leonardo development board and GSM module. Arduino IDE code platform wasused in the software phase. Incase of anydanger, a warningmessagewill be sent tothe mobile phonefromtheCappadocia GSM modulebyapplyingthe data communicationalgorithm. Afterthewarningsignal is received, theroutines in the mobile phone software will be activated. It has beenobservedthatthesystemworkssuccessfullyanddetectsthelocation of thevisuallyimpairedindividualaccurately. Therearemanystudies in theliteraturedesignedforvisuallyimpairedpeople. Inthesestudies, it wasseenthatthecircuitand software designsdevelopedfordifferentsystemsweresimilar. ThankstotheCappadocia GSM Shieldweused in ourstudy, it is aimedtokeepthecostlowbycombiningmanyfunctions.
